Workshop Overview

More than an in-depth review, this workshop includes the things you asked for:  clouds, running water, more people & glass.

​Kath Macaulay is back to offer those who have had the pleasure of joining one of her Pocket Sketching® workshops advanced techniques that will take their work to the next level.

New are the use of pencil, dilute paint and permanent pen such as ballpoint (best of both worlds allows sketches in five minutes for travel), journaling & people in their environment.  Add working super-fast, under duress, from memory, a moving subject plus your requests during class.  It's all in your grasp - but truly advanced!

Lesson Plan

Day 1 
Morning - Studio
  • Handling the paint set
  • Use of arm (not just fingers) to transfer 'chi' to drawing
  • Review use of pen, perspective lessons of contrast, color & focal point. Using these lessons to emphasize focal point.
  • Staying on focal point while using difficult subject
  • Finishing in 25 minutes or less
  • Escape into meditation while working, eliminating 'the pressure of the real world.
Afternoon - Studio & adjacent area
  • Wash drawing, monochromatic
  • Wash drawing with only point(s) of color
  • Wash drawing 'vignette' with emphasized focal point and undeveloped edges
  • Wash drawing maintaining whites as design element
  • Under duress, sketching from windows or equivalent, working up finished sketch in color later

Day 2 
All Day in Studio
  • Journaling books, equipment comparisons
  • Journaling groups
  • Practice with greeting cards, sketchbook (including words)
  • John Singer Sargent methods, emphasizing use of wax, hiding mistakes  and pencil
  • Use of permanent pen and washes
  • Capturing a moving subject
  • Developing use of memory when drawing live subjects
  • Interiors
  • Sketching with  dilute  paint
  • Permanent pen


Day 3
Plein Aire (or if indoors)
  • Working under duress using car or building windows
  • Catching people, etc., in motion using substitutes & memory
  • People in their environment
  • Journaling, incorporating words with calligraphic pen
  • Using reproductions & photographs 

All exercises will emphasize speed of execution to retain focal point,  eliminate excessive detail.  Frequent demonstrations and critiques after each exercise (or at end of afternoon when outdoors). 
All critiques are supportive: if ready for a tougher critique, as I give myself, ask for it!

Objective

​To be able to sketch or journal anywhere, under any circumstances, fearlessly in 25 minutes or less
Know the tremendous advantages of your equipment
Be able to travel anywhere, by any means,  and capture anything you think you see
Escape into meditation while  sketching
